Match Summary

Zenit Saint Petersburg and Spartak Moscow drew 0:0. The match was played in Premier League 2023. 8 yellow cards were shown. Zenit Saint Petersburg had 62% possession while Spartak Moscow held 38%. Zenit Saint Petersburg had 7 shots (2 on target) compared to 11 (3 on target) for Spartak Moscow. Zenit Saint Petersburg made 4 substitutions, Spartak Moscow made 3.

Match Statistics

Zenit Saint Petersburg had 62% possession against Spartak Moscow's 38%. Zenit Saint Petersburg registered 7 shots (2 on target) while Spartak Moscow managed 11 (3 on target). Corner kicks: 8–4. Fouls committed: 9–15.
